Joomla 1.6 will reach end-of-life on August 19, 2011 and all users should upgrade to version 1.7 before that date.Version 1.7.0 was released to the public yesterday and includes an important fix for a cross-site scripting vulnerability in Joomla 1.6, underscoring the urgency of upgrading.
Upgrading from Joomla 1.6.5 to 1.7.0 (and future versions) is now a simple 1-click task built right into the Joomla core. We recommend that all Joomla 1.6 users use this quick and simple method.
Please note that this upgrade path is specific for Joomla 1.6.5 ONLY.In addition to security enhancements and 1-click upgrades, Joomla 1.7 contains a number of feature enhancements including better form validation, batch processing of articles and an improved ability to restrict article submission to specific categories.
